About Ravangla Sikkim
Ravangla Sikkim is a cozy small town in South Sikkim, part of the Ravangla area.
It sits at around 7,000 feet (2,134 meters) high. From here, you get killer sights of snowy giants like Kanchenjunga.
Ravangla Distance & Connectivity
Here are easy travel distances to Ravangla:
✯ Ravangla to Gangtok: ~65 km (2.5-3 hours drive)
✯ Ravangla to Pelling: ~52 km (about 2 hours)
✯ Ravangla to Siliguri: ~125 km (4-5 hours)

Ravangla Sightseeing Places
1. Buddha Park (Tathagata Tsal)

This gem shines with a massive 130-ft golden Buddha statue sitting tall over green valleys and snow peaks. Walk around for calm morning views, snap epic pics of Kanchenjunga, and feel the peace—great family stop.
2. Ralang Monastery

Tucked in quiet hills, this spot buzzes with prayer flags, monk chants, and old stone walls—super spiritual with fresh mountain air. Join a puja or just soak in the serenity after a short drive.
3. Maenam Hill

Head here for fun treks through thick forests, wild orchids, and rhododendrons—3-4 hour hike rewards you with 360° views of peaks and valleys. Spot birds and deer; pack water and good shoes.
4. Bön Monastery

A rare find—one of India's few Bön spots with ancient rituals, colorful murals, and mountain backdrops. Learn about pre-Buddhist vibes from friendly monks;
quiet and cultural.
Ravangla to Pelling Trip
The drive from Ravangla to Pelling is full of pretty mountain sights. It takes about 2 hours and works great if you want to see both spots in one go.
Ravangla to Gangtok Trip
Getting from Ravangla to Gangtok takes around 3 hours. Grab a cab or hop on shared taxis to keep costs low.
Why Visit Ravangla?
Ravangla is a must for its clean hill air, awesome Kanchenjunga views, and quiet spots away from crowds. Nature fans, trekkers, and culture seekers love it on Sikkim trips.

Pretty Nature Wake up to pink snow peaks at dawn, misty tea fields down the hills, and simple paths with wildflowers or deer. Rayong waterfall roars close by, and Ralang hot springs feel like a warm hug—perfect add-on for trips from Siliguri with Darjeeling.

Spiritual & Local Feels Check out Buddha Park's huge statue and Ralang Monastery's soft chants—they draw you right into Sikkim life. Watch Pang Lhabsol dances for mountains, sip warm butter tea with kind Lepcha folks, and peek at old Bön ways—it's warm and real.

Fun & Easy Reach Climb Maenam Hill for full-circle views or use it as home base for South Sikkim—just 4-5 hours from Siliguri on winding roads. Cheap stays, nice weather most times, and no big crowds make it right for families or going alone, skipping Gangtok bustle.
Travel Tips for Ravangla
Best Time to Go
Head to Ravangla from March to June or September to December. Weather stays nice and cool—great for roaming around and seeing sights without any trouble.

Spring Fun (March-May)

Think sunny days at 10-20°C, flowers all over, and super clear views of big mountains. Perfect for family walks, Maenam Hill climbs, and snaps with Kanchenjunga behind you.

Fall Magic (September–November)

Enjoy cool 8–18°C breezes, lush green landscapes after monsoon, and stunning snow peak views. You can also experience local festivals like Pang Lhabsol. Roads from Siliguri to Ravangla are smoother and travel becomes more comfortable.

Easy Travel Tips

✯ Carry warm clothes due to the high Ravangla height (7,000 ft)
✯ Book hotels in advance during peak season
✯ Avoid monsoon (June–August) due to landslides
✯ Skip extreme winter (December–February) if you don’t like cold
✯ Evenings always need a light jacket!

Ravangla Sikkim is a small hill town located in the South Sikkim district of India. It is known for its peaceful environment and Himalayan views.
The Ravangla height is around 7,000 feet (2134 meters) above sea level, making it a cool and scenic hill destination.
Popular Ravangla sightseeing attractions include:

✯ Buddha Park
✯ Ralong Monastery
✯ Maenam Hill
✯ Bon Monastery
The Ravangla to Gangtok distance is approximately 65 km, and it takes around 2.5 to 3 hours by road.
The Ravangla to Pelling distance is around 50–52 km, which takes about 2 hours by car.
The Ravangla Sikkim distance from Siliguri is about 120–125 km, and it takes approximately 4–5 hours by road.
Ravangla is located in the South Sikkim district, often referred to as the Ravangla district region.
The best time to visit Ravangla Sikkim is from March to June and September to November, when the weather is pleasant and ideal for travel.
Yes, Ravangla is perfect for honeymoon couples, families, and nature lovers due to its peaceful atmosphere and scenic beauty.
You can reach Ravangla via road from:

✯ Gangtok
✯ Pelling
✯ Siliguri

The nearest railway station is New Jalpaiguri (NJP), and the nearest airport is Bagdogra.
